Soo I just got done setting up my reef octopus bh1000. Seems to be working just like everyone said it would. Whats with all the microbubbles talk. People say its bad. Is it just reef tanks that these are bad for? I have heard caN be bad for clams and certain fish? Just hoping someone can answer.. thanks
 
Not bad at all, some ppl are during the night do the micronano bubbling.
If you experience micro bubbles as we speak I suspect the cause of that is your skimmer breaking in.
 
Exactly what it was. This reply is about 2 weeks old and skimmer is working great. No bubbles at all. However today is cleaning day. Skimmer has been working great and im afraid im gonna mess it up ;)
